The play was a sort of a comment on a performers life. There was a lot of nudity involved. Which I actually found slightly embarassing. The actress involved appeared nude twice, once at the beginning and once at the end I ended up thinking enough already. It was fairly typical modern experimental theatre lots of different media and at one point she was hypnotized and ate an onion. The trouble with yer actual performers commenting on the art of acting is they end up being fearful of the audience. Actors always seem to get round to feeling rejected. I don't know if it was very brave or very self indulgent or a mixture of both. The play was called Me Me Me. I thought actually at the end when the performer was nude the audience seemed to accept her for who she was but then audience tend to be forgiving.
